About Jiaye Lu

Jiaye Lu is a scholar working on Immunology, Molecular Biology, Oncology, Dermatology and Neurology, having authored 15 papers that have together received 556 indexed citations. Recurring topics across this work include Dermatology and Skin Diseases (3 papers), Psoriasis: Treatment and Pathogenesis (3 papers), Phagocytosis and Immune Regulation (2 papers), Asthma and respiratory diseases (2 papers), Cancer-related molecular mechanisms research (2 papers), Immunotherapy and Immune Responses (2 papers), RNA modifications and cancer (2 papers) and Immune cells in cancer (2 papers). The work is most often cited by research in Cancer Research (205 citations), Pulmonary and Respiratory Medicine (224 citations), Immunology (99 citations), Molecular Biology (306 citations) and Oncology (116 citations). Jiaye Lu has collaborated with scholars based in China, United States and Macao. Frequent co-authors include Xiaolei Zhang, Shumin Ouyang, Peiqing Liu, Ziyou Lin, Peibin Yue, Huaxuan Li, Linlin Lou, Wen Ding, Yuanxiang Wang and Zhenhua Zhang. Their work appears in journals such as Frontiers in Immunology, Journal of Advanced Research, Talanta, Neurological Sciences and Cancer Letters.
